Nutrition Facts
Noodles, egg, cooked, enriched, with added salt
Serving size 1 x 100 grams (100g)
Amount Per Serving
Calories
138
% Daily Value*
Fiber, total dietary: 1.200 g
Protein: 4.540 g
Water: 67.700 g
Sugars, total: 0.400 g
Total lipid (fat): 2.070 g
Fatty acids, total monounsaturated: 0.581 g
Fatty acids, total polyunsaturated: 0.552 g
Fatty acids, total saturated: 0.419 g
Cholesterol: 29.000 mg
Carbohydrate, by difference: 25.200 g
Energy: 138.000 kcal
Vitamin C, total ascorbic acid: 0.000 mg
Thiamin: 0.289 mg
Riboflavin: 0.136 mg
Vitamin B-12: 0.090 µg
Vitamin K (phylloquinone): 0.000 µg
Vitamin A, IU: 21.000 IU
Vitamin A, RAE: 6.000 µg
Vitamin E (alpha-tocopherol): 0.170 mg
Niacin: 2.080 mg
Vitamin B-6: 0.046 mg
Folate, DFE: 138.000 µg
